Output 307f72da2ac8069ae45c25de321c8c027c37c68ced6fa14474276881e0a72ef2:17

value
3893914
script pubkey
OP_0 OP_PUSHBYTES_20 53ed1ade7e96edafb2720e8ab8b845990ab9a8e9
address
bc1q20k34hn7jmk6lvnjp69t3wz9ny9tn28f96999h
transaction
307f72da2ac8069ae45c25de321c8c027c37c68ced6fa14474276881e0a72ef2